So, I'm going to go out on a limb and blame zoloft for my inability to lose weight.
I got on it in July 2009 (and off Effexor) prior to TTC my second.. I weighed 142 at that dr's appt. In October, after a BFP I weighed in at 150ish. I miscarried in November and weighed 155.. I attributed it to the pregnancy. In March 2010 I got another BFP and weighed 162 at my intake. In April I miscarried and weighed about 165. In June I was pregnant again and quit the zoloft cold turkey. I went down to 160 before heading up in the weight gain for that pregnancy.
I weighed 177 when I had DS (Feb 2011) and got down to about 168 by about June and restarted the zoloft. I now weigh 160ish. The weight has not budged in months. I track my diet, I exercise.. sometimes it will go down a few pounds.. but even basic math should tell me there is something going on.
So, I'm on a different med and weaning the zoloft, but I guess my point is.. has anyone else had a problem on zoloft with weight?

I was actually just speaking with a therapist friend of mine about Zoloft a couple of days ago. She said that Zoloft is one of the meds that many doctors prescribe for patients with anorexia or bulimia due to it's pretty common side affect of weight gain.
She said that weight gain is a very common side affect of many similar types of drugs.
